The Allure of Decentralization: A Web3 Dream
The buzz around Web3 has fueled much of the excitement surrounding the metaverse, and for good reason. The promise of decentralization is powerful: user ownership, transparency, and freedom from the control of large corporations. In a decentralized metaverse, assets like virtual land, avatars, and items exist as NFTs (Non-Fungible Tokens) on a blockchain. This means users truly own their digital assets, they're not just licenses controlled by a centralized platform.
Real-World Example: Consider projects like Decentraland or The Sandbox. Users own land parcels, develop experiences on them, and trade their creations without needing permission from a central authority. The core experience of ownership and control resides in the user, just like owning a physical piece of property. Think about how revolutionary this is compared to current gaming platforms where you spend money, but never really own anything! It’s a paradigm shift that empowers creators and users, fostering a sense of real digital ownership.
For me, the journey towards incorporating decentralized technologies has been exciting, yet demanding. Early on, when integrating smart contracts into a virtual experience, I ran into issues with gas fees – sometimes they were ridiculously high and made micro-transactions impossible. It was a harsh reality check on the practical challenges of on-chain transactions, something that I had only read about in articles. Lesson learned: decentralized tech is powerful but must be implemented thoughtfully to prevent it from being unusable for common users.
The Efficiency of Centralized Control: Power and Pitfalls
On the other end of the spectrum, we have centralized platforms. These are the metaverses controlled by a single company. Think of early social games or large VR platforms. Centralized control offers clear advantages, primarily in terms of efficiency and scalability. A single entity can make rapid changes, enforce rules consistently, and maintain quality and performance through centralized servers. There's also a clearer roadmap for monetization, which in turn fuels further development.
Real-World Example: Games like Fortnite and Roblox offer vast, engaging virtual worlds. These experiences are controlled by the company that developed them, which has ultimate power over user accounts, content, and even user-generated content. While such centralized systems might lack the radical user freedom of decentralized ones, they offer a smoother and more predictable experience with far less friction for onboarding new users. This ease of access often makes them wildly popular for a wider, less technically savvy, audience.
I remember contributing to a project that was essentially a large, interactive educational simulation running on a centralized platform. Building it was comparatively faster, the deployment process was way simpler, and scaling for thousands of simultaneous users was manageable. But there was also a constant awareness of not having true control over the platform itself, it was always dependent on the central company. Key takeaway: Centralized systems are great for speed and efficiency but come at the cost of user autonomy and are often susceptible to platform whims.
The Tug-of-War: Finding a Balance
The reality is, the metaverse will likely not be purely decentralized or purely centralized. What we’re seeing now is a spectrum, with various platforms adopting different balances. We're seeing 'hybrid' models where centralized aspects like user interface and core services interact with decentralized systems like NFT-based digital assets.
Here are a few areas where this tension is particularly pronounced and how I've seen it play out in practice:
- Data Privacy and User Control: In centralized metaverses, user data is often controlled by the platform provider. This raises questions about privacy and the potential for misuse. Decentralized systems, with their reliance on blockchain, offer the promise of user-controlled data. However, we still have to be mindful of anonymity and how to provide a user-friendly experience in the absence of a central system for user recovery.
- Content Creation and Governance: In centralized spaces, content is typically moderated by the platform, which can lead to concerns about censorship and the lack of representation. Decentralized metaverses often enable open creation and governance by users, but this introduces its own challenge of moderation, scalability, and potentially the risk of malicious content.
- Monetization and Economic Models: Centralized metaverses often operate on a proprietary economic model controlled by the platform. Decentralized spaces leverage crypto and blockchain which allows for user to user trading and the possibility of true ownership of assets. The key is to ensure that both these systems are designed to be inclusive, fair, and transparent.
Navigating these challenges involves a thorough understanding of how both centralized and decentralized systems work and an iterative design approach that is always ready to embrace feedback. My suggestion: Always start with the user experience in mind, not the technology. Let the desired user experience guide the underlying architecture.
Practical Tips for Developers: Navigating the Maze
So, how do we, as developers, navigate this complex landscape? Here are some practical tips I've gleaned from my own experience:
- Start Small, Iterate Often: Don’t try to build everything on-chain from day one. Begin with a proof of concept that addresses the main problems, measure your results and then iterate. Consider which components can benefit from decentralization and which aspects may be more efficient in a centralized environment.
- Prioritize User Experience: Decentralization shouldn’t come at the cost of ease of use. Ensure that user interfaces are intuitive, even when interacting with blockchain technology. Aim for a seamless user experience that hides the complexity of the underlying infrastructure. Consider 'abstracting' away the technical bits of crypto for the user and offering options that might not require blockchain interaction in a simple way.
- Embrace Open Standards and Interoperability: Avoid creating walled gardens. Design your metaverse with an emphasis on open standards that allow users to bring their assets and identity between different platforms.
- Test, Test, Test (with real users): Don't just focus on the technical aspects. Conduct user testing with a diverse audience to understand how they interact with your metaverse. Gather feedback early and continuously iterate to meet user needs.
- Educate Yourself (And Your Users): The metaverse, blockchain and Web3 are still relatively new. Invest time in educating yourself about the technology and the potential risks and benefits. Educate your users about their rights and responsibilities within your metaverse.
Let me share a quick example of how we approached this on a recent project.
We were developing a virtual art gallery, and initially, we wanted everything to be fully decentralized. However, the complexity of interacting with the blockchain made the user experience clunky, especially for non-crypto users. We ended up opting for a hybrid approach: the art pieces were represented as NFTs on the blockchain, but the user interface for browsing and purchasing art was managed through a centralized system. It wasn’t ideal, but it offered a smooth experience for a broader audience and still maintained the core principle of decentralized asset ownership.
